The venoms add another forward to the already star-studded frontline that has Mohamed Salem, Gusto Mulongo, Kenneth Kimera, Annest Ankunda, and Yunus Sentamu.
Vipers Sports Club have confirmed the acquisition of Uganda Cranes forward Isaac Ogwang ahead of the second round of the Startimes Uganda Premier league.
A whole package delivered on the transfer deadline day, Ogwang penned down a two year contract, running until January, 2027.

The 27-year-old joins the Kitende-based entity from new comers Police Football Club.
Clinical Infront of the goal, Ogwang played a crucial role as the cops earned promotion back to the top-flight, with 12 goals in the process.
Even this season he continued to prove his goal-scoring exploits, netting 6 times in 13 appearances for Police in the first round.
The former Villa and Arua Hill player becomes Vipers second signing from the just concluded window after the return of midfielder Marvin Youngman.
Ogwang could make his debut next week when the six-time winners welcome the tax collectors of URA Football Club at St Mary’s Stadium.
